The compatibility of Illinois etexts across various devices really depends on the specific platform they're using. In my experience, most of the etexts I've encountered, especially those published through university systems, tend to offer a pretty flexible format. Typically, they can be accessed through web browsers, which means laptops, desktops, and tablets can usually handle them without any issues. However, I’ve had mixed results on e-readers and smartphones—it’s a hit or miss depending on the app required to read them.

Some of the etexts use proprietary software that might not be available on all devices, which can cause some frustration when you’re on the go and just want to catch up on some reading. Honestly, I always make sure to check which formats are available before I get too invested in a particular title. Plus, it’s good to keep a backup device handy—nothing worse than finding out your favorite book isn’t accessible on your go-to gadget!

When I’ve found etexts compatible with formats like PDF or ePub, that makes life so much easier since those are widely supported. Are libraries with ebooks compatible with all e-reader devices?

3 Answers2025-06-06 10:15:50
I love reading ebooks and have tried different devices over the years. Not all libraries with ebooks are compatible with every e-reader out there. For example, Kindle users often face issues because Amazon’s format doesn’t play nice with some library systems like OverDrive unless you use the Libby app. On the other hand, Kobo and other EPUB-friendly readers usually work smoothly with library loans. It’s frustrating when you find a great book only to realize your device won’t support it. Always check your library’s supported formats and apps before getting too excited about a title. Some libraries even offer tutorials to help you set things up properly. I’ve also noticed that newer e-readers tend to have better compatibility, but older models might struggle. It’s worth researching your specific device or even asking your local librarian for advice. They’re usually super helpful and can point you in the right direction.
